fols. 113-18, 137-41, 164-93 of a composite volume. Bound and foliated in MSS/0175*.
Consists of MSS/0190 (Ellis, arts.1,4,5). As follows:-
190 (Ellis, art.1). Extracts by Thomas Allen from the Archiepiscopal Registers at Lambeth, including (fol. 117 r, v) a copy of the will of Thomas Trilleck, Bp of Rochester, 1372. fols. 113-18;-
190 (Ellis, art.4). Extracts by Allen relating to the patronage of benefices in the diocese of Rochester, receipts, grants, etc., extract from the Custumale Roffense, not printed by John Thorpe, junior (fol. 185), letter of John Thorpe, senior, to John Baynard, 15 May 1726 (fols. 177-8v) mentioning Allen and another copyist, Mr Madox. fols. 165-93;-
190 (Ellis, art.5). References to the Patent Rolls extracted by Baynard, under parishes in Kent. fols. 138-41.
